Company Description

Paredim Partners LLC is a premier owner and operator of multi-family residential properties in the Northeastern United States, specializing in the New York Metropolitan area and Connecticut marketplace. Founded in 2002, the firm has a significant track record in opportunistic multifamily investment and developments, with over 3,000 apartment units and $300 million in investment transactions. Paredim Communities, the firm's in-house management group, provides local expertise and hands-on approach to its portfolio.

Role Description

This is a full-time on-site role in Elmsford, NY for a Real Estate Asset Management & Acquisitions Analyst. The Analyst will be responsible for daily tasks related to asset management, acquisitions, and investment analysis in multi-family residential properties.

RESPONSIBILITIES

·Create and utilize financial models to underwrite prospective acquisition opportunities

·Model hold/sell/refinance scenarios and various JV/partnership analyses

·Analyze market data including operating fundamentals and comparable rent/sale data

·Assist capital markets initiatives and executions by analyzing various debt and equity financing scenarios

·Maintain and update acquisitions pipeline

·Participate in property inspections and market tours

·Prepare presentations and written investment committee memorandums

·Participate in the preparation of annual operating budgets

·Analyze and monitor property and portfolio operational and financial performance

·Evaluate property capital improvement programs including costs/benefit analyses

·Provide support to required loan servicing obligations
